    Essential Duties & Responsibilities

    Leadership & Operations

    + Build, coach, and inspire a high-performing global HR Shared Services team focused on innovation, accountability, and continuous improvement.

    + Oversee the daily operation of the HR Service Center, including case management, tiered issue resolution, knowledge base maintenance, and SLA performance.

    + Partner with HR COEs and IT to align technology, processes, and integrations across HR, Payroll, training and vendor systems.

    + Serve as escalation point for complex HR issues requiring nuanced judgment, confidentiality, and collaboration across HR, Legal, and leadership teams.

    + Ensure alignment between HR operations, compliance, and employee experience initiatives in support of Greene Tweed’s business goals.

    Employee Relations & Compliance

    + Conduct and oversee internal investigations in partnership with Legal and HR leadership, ensuring fairness, objectivity, and timely resolution.

    + Make recommendations ranging from company policies and procedures to individual investigations.

    + Provide coaching and guidance to managers, HR business partners, and employees regarding performance, conduct, and policy matters.

    + Identify and monitor regulatory requirements impacting HR programs and processes, ensuring compliance with federal, state, and local employment laws.

    + Develop and deliver training programs on harassment, discrimination, ethics, and workplace standards.

    + Partner with HR leadership and Legal to manage compliance reporting, audits, and responses to external agencies.

    + Support labor relations strategies, collective bargaining preparations, and dispute resolution efforts as needed.

    Program & Project Management

    + Lead HR Shared Services projects and enterprise-wide HR initiatives, ensuring timely execution, risk mitigation, and measurable outcomes.

    + Serve as a strategic partner and “quarterback” in the HR roadmap development, aligning Shared Services priorities to enterprise HR programs (onboarding, engagement, compliance, and retention).

    + Drive operational excellence through spearheading a series of Quarterly Business Reviews to monitor progress of our HR Roadmap; provide regular (monthly) updates to HR Leadership team.

    + Coordinate governance activities across HR—including policy reviews, employee committees (ERGs), and compliance programs—to ensure consistency and collaboration.

    + Partner with Legal to ensure HR practices support a safe, compliant, and inclusive workplace.

    Analytics & Continuous Improvement

    + Analyze HR service and ER metrics to identify performance gaps and improvement opportunities.

    + Develop and deliver executive-ready dashboards and presentations summarizing key insights, risks, and outcomes.

    + Leverage automation and technology (e.g., Workday, Ivanti) to enhance service delivery and compliance tracking.

    Collaboration & Global Partnership

    + Partner across global HR, Legal, and business functions to deliver integrated, proactive HR solutions across regions.

    + Build strong relationships across manufacturing and corporate environments to ensure alignment between HR programs and operational priorities.

    + Actively participate as part of the extended HR Leadership Team, contributing to organizational strategy, HR policy development, and driving the delivery of proactive HR solutions.

    Education & Experience

    +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, or related field required; advanced degree or HR certification (SPHR/SHRM-SCP) preferred.

    + 10+ years of progressive HR experience, including HR operations, shared services, employee relations, or compliance; 5-7 years of experience with complex employee relations & investigations.

    + Strong working knowledge of employment law, investigations, HRIS (Workday or similar), and ticketing platforms (ServiceNow, Ivanti, Zendesk).

    + Ability to comprehend, interpret, and apply the appropriate sections of applicable laws, guidelines, regulations, ordinances, and policies.

    + Thorough understanding of negotiation techniques, dispute resolution and demonstrated ability to remain tactful, calm, and objective in controversial and/or confrontational situations.

    + Demonstrated success leading HR programs, projects and portfolios with cross-functional impact.

    + Proven ability to lead change, communicate effectively at all levels, and influence outcomes through data and storytelling.

    + Customer-service oriented mindset with exceptional communication, problem-solving, and judgment; ability to influence and coach at all organizational levels.

    + Manufacturing industry experience and union/labor relations familiarity preferred.
